如何在bash中将变量传递给expect文件?

时间:2018-01-10 10:04:29

标签: bash expect

我看过这篇文章: How to pass local shell script variable to expect?

但我的期望脚本是一个单独的文件,而不是他的。

我有一个期望的脚本文件:

#!/usr/bin/expect

send "echo 'hello' \n"

exit 0

我还有一个bash脚本文件:

#!/bin/bash

a="Neil"
b="Thunel"

expect ./test01.exp 

if [ $? == 0 ]; then
    echo "success!"
else
    echo "fail!"
fi  

我想将$a$b传递给expect文件,但我不知道如何处理。

0 个答案:

没有答案